grumpypenguin Posted April 10, 2014 #5 Share Posted April 10, 2014 We went snorkeling with Crystal Seas Adventures last Saturday (4/5/2014). We saw lots of fish, three turtles, and a sting ray. Our guide, Daniel, mentioned that he knew of a spot to see nurse sharks, but we were more interested in fish so we didn't go there. We had a wonderful time on this trip and I would highly recommend it.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
canadakath Posted April 10, 2014 #6 Share Posted April 10, 2014 We went snorkelling with Blue Water Divers last Saturday, saw lots of fish, a whale splash (tried to get to the whale but it never resurfaced), sting ray, but no turtles. Vicky was great to work with ahead of the trip. Our tour was supposed to have up to 16 snorkelers, but we lucked out and had just the 6 in our group. Had a fantastic time!
